Understanding Third-Party Testing
Third-party testing involves sending hemp products to an independent laboratory to verify the contents of a product. These labs conduct tests to assess hemp-based products’ potency, purity, and safety, ensuring they meet regulatory standards. Third-party testing provides a transparent and unbiased evaluation unlike in-house testing, which could be biased or unreliable.

Detecting Harmful Contaminants
One of the major concerns with unregulated hemp products is the potential presence of contaminants such as pesticides, heavy metals, solvents, or mold. These harmful substances can pose serious health risks if consumed. Through third-party testing, hemp companies can confirm that their products are free from these contaminants, ensuring a safer experience for users.
Verifying Legal Compliance
Hemp products are subject to strict regulations, especially regarding THC content. The 2018 Farm Bill legalized hemp-derived products, provided they contain less than 0.3% THC. Third-party testing verifies that products comply with these legal limits, helping consumers stay within legal boundaries while enjoying their hemp-based products. This is crucial for those who want to avoid any legal complications while enjoying the potential benefits of hemp.
